Seven complex monoterpenoid indole-quinoline and bisindole alkaloids, suadimins D-J (1-7), with previously unreported carbon-carbon linkages, were isolated and identified from the twigs and leaves of Melodinus suaveolens. Their structures were determined through a combination of diverse methods, with a focus on extensive spectroscopic data analysis and electric circular dichroism (ECD) calculations. The cytotoxicity of these compounds against three cancer cell lines was evaluated, and some showed moderate activities with IC50 values ranging from 2.4 to 8.0 μM.
